Kruger, South Africa
Synonymous
with Big 5, Kruger Park in South Africa offers a host of experiences not only
in terms of wildlife but also in terms of accommodation and dining as well. This
one of the most celebrated parks in South Africa welcomes a large number of
travellers who come here in pursuit of watching elephant, lion, rhino, leopard
and buffalo in their natural setting. Guided tour to the park is available for
vacationers. The park also boasts some luxury accommodation options. The

Duba, Botswana
Situated
on the northern reaches of Botswana's famed Okavango Delta, this private
77,000-acre reserve may be a year round destination but it is accessible
through aircraft only. And perhaps its
remoteness that makes it all the more interesting. With several channels and an
array of islands, the park is a great place to see wildlife from close
quarters. Elephant, red lechwe, antelope, hippo, crocodile, kudu, impala,
mongoose, warthog and tsessebe are some of the common inhabitants of this park.
Excellent staying options are available at this park.
One of the biggest draw cards of Tanzania, Ruaha National Park is complete
wilderness with great landscape and diverse wildlife. Known for its raw beauty
diverse landscape constituting hills, plains and rivers lined with acacia
plants, tourist find it hard to stop then falling in love with this place. The
park is a treasure trove of birds, animals, amphibians and reptiles. Kudu,
lions, leopards, cheetah, giraffes, zebras, elands, impala, bat eared foxes and
Jackals are common inhabitants.
Maasai Mara, Kenya
Situated in South West Kenya, Maasai Mara is one of the most prominent
wildlife reserves in Africa. The park is blessed with gently sloping grassland
making animal spotting easier. Together
with Tanzania's Serengeti, it makes a perfect setting for famous migration. The
park is frequented by people for a great safari experience and having a
cultural interaction with local Maasai communities. Apart from big 5, the park
also has a great concentration of other animals as well.
Considered
as one of the greatest wildlife reserves of the continent, South Luangwa National
Park in Zambia is well known for its high concentration of animals. The park
houses 60 species of animals and 400 species of birds. The visitors can spot a
large number of hippos and lions on their visit.
